Default 2000 Bonneville starting problems. Help

Just picked up a 2000 Bonneville. Started up just fine, shut it off, and then decided to start it up again right away and it didn't want to start. It was acting like it wanted to hit, but just wouldn't. After a few tries it finally started. General concensus was I shut if off while it was still on high idle and was just loaded up as you could smell a little fuel. Drove it home and it ran great. Stopped to get gas, no problem. Next morning it started just fine. Pulled it back to the garage to do a couple things to it. Went into town, came back, changed oil, air filter, just general maintenance stuff. Won't start. Doing the same thing. It acts like it wants to, but won't. Went to my dad's house to pick up his fuel pressure tester, came back (10 minutes) hooked up the tester, made a dumb mistake and instead of just turning the key on to read the gage, I hit the starter...and it started. Tried 3 or 4 more times periodically after that and it started every time. But I'm a little gun shy now. Any ideas??
